Kidney cancer Treatment Overview
- CyberKnife - from $4750
This therapy is a non-invasive option using precise radiation for treating cancerous and non-cancerous tumors.
- Gamma Knife - from $4500
This therapy is a non-invasive, high precision radiation treatment for brain disorders, offering fast recovery and minimal side effects.
- Proton-beam therapy - from $1500
This therapy treats tumors with high-energy protons, targeting only sick cells, sparing healthy tissues, reducing side effects.
- Nephrectomy - from $1400
The operation removes a kidney to treat diseases like cancer, offering a potential cure and improved quality of life.
- Da Vinci Robotic System - from $7548
The procedure uses advanced robotics for precise, minimally invasive surgeries, offering more control and quicker recovery.
- NanoKnife - from $45000
This therapy uses electric pulses to target and destroy harmful cells, offering precise, minimal side-effects treatment.
- Radiation therapy for colorectal cancer - from $3250
This procedure uses high-energy rays to destroy colorectal cancer cells, an effective and targeted treatment method.
- Chemotherapy for breast cancer - from $1161
This therapy targets and destroys breast cancer cells, using powerful drugs, enhancing survival and recovery rates.
- Immunotherapy for kidney cancer - from $4064
This therapy boosts the body"s natural defenses, often prolonging life in kidney cancer patients.
- Cryotherapy for kidney cancer - from $8000
This therapy freezes kidney cancer cells, using thin probes introduced through small incisions, effective and minimally invasive.
- Nephrectomy with Da Vinci Robot - from $7896
The procedure uses robotic assistance for kidney removal, ensuring precision, minimal invasiveness, and a quicker recovery.
- Radiation therapy for kidney cancer - from $3250
This therapy uses high-energy rays to destruct kidney cancer cells, providing a non-surgical, targeted treatment option.

- the curability of patients at the stage 1-2 of renal cell carcinoma is 70%;
- the survival rate for the stage 3A is 66%;
- the survival rate for the stages 3-B and 4 is more than 20%.
Methods of kidney cancer treatment of in Ichilov (Sourasky)
- Laparoscopic removal, cryoablation (freezing) of the tumor (at the stage 1-A);
- sectoral resection, including the da Vinci robotic-assisted system (at stage 1-2A );
- Nephrectomy, i.e. removal of affected kidney with other concerned structures;
- Embolization of target renal artery. Embolus (artificial blood clot) is introduced to restrict the blood supply to the tumor. Reduced (and weakened) colony of atypical cells are removed in a while.
